I built a virtual home lab using VirtualBox to gain hands-on cybersecurity experience. The lab featured two VMs: one running Ubuntu Linux and the other Windows 11, with internal networks configured for communication. I enhanced my scripting skills in PowerShell and Bash while practicing malware analysis, endpoint security, and email security in a sandboxed environment. Using tools like CyberChef, Wireshark, tcpdump, Snort, and Splunk, I analyzed network traffic, detected anomalies, and managed logs. This project sharpened my technical skills, problem-solving abilities, and understanding of secure configurations and threat detection.

I developed Python scripts to filter and aggregate data from PCAP files, enhancing my understanding of network traffic analysis and cybersecurity workflows. Using libraries like Scapy and PyShark, I parsed PCAP files, identified key protocols, and extracted details like IP addresses, ports, and timestamps. The scripts summarized TCP conversations, top protocols, and other statistics, automating tasks that streamline packet analysis. This project deepened my understanding of networking concepts, improved my Python skills, and provided hands-on experience with real-world cybersecurity data. By automating data analysis, I demonstrated my ability to create tools for intrusion detection, threat hunting, and troubleshooting network environments.
